OJJDP launched the Healing Indigenous Lives Initiative with United National Indian Tribal Youth, Inc. Youth Poster Contest Winners Announced

UNITY partnered with Bowman Performance Consulting (BPC) to sponsor a poster contest for art created to encourage Indigenous youth and young adults to participate in the Covid-19 Impacts study. Of those who submitted art graphics, three winners were chosen for First, Second, and Third place with cash prizes of $250, $150, and $100, respectively.
